package protocol
import (
"fmt"
"io"
)
// Serializable is a type which can be serialized into a packet.
// This is used by protocol_builder when the struct tag 'as' is set
// to "raw".
type Serializable interface {
Serialize(w io.Writer) error
Deserialize(r io.Reader) error
}
//go:generate stringer -type=State
// State defined which state the protocol is in.
type State int
// States of the protocol.
// Handshaking is default.
const (
Handshaking State = 0
Play State = 1
Status State = 2
Login State = 3
)
const (
// SupportedProtocolVersion is current protocol version this package defines
SupportedProtocolVersion = 71
)
const (
clientbound = iota
serverbound
)
const maxPacketCount = 100
var packetCreator [4][2][maxPacketCount]func() Packet
// VarInt is a variable length integer with a cap of
// 32 bits
type VarInt int32
// VarLong is a variable length integer with a cap of
// 64 bits
type VarLong int64
// Position is a location in the world packed into a 64 bit integer
type Position uint64
// NewPosition creates a Position for the given location.
func NewPosition(x, y, z int) Position {
return ((Position(x) & 0x3FFFFFF) << 38) |
((Position(y) & 0xFFF) << 26) |
(Position(z) & 0x3FFFFFF)
}
// X returns the X component of the position
func (p Position) X() int {
return int(int64(p) >> 38)
}
// Y returns the Y component of the position
func (p Position) Y() int {
return int((int64(p) >> 26) & 0xFFF)
}
// Z returns the Z component of the position
func (p Position) Z() int {
return int(int64(p) << 38 >> 38)
}
// String returns a string representation of the position
func (p Position) String() string {
return fmt.Sprintf("%d,%d,%d", p.X(), p.Y(), p.Z())
}
// UUID is an unique identifier
type UUID [16]byte
// Serialize serializes the uuid into the writer
func (u *UUID) Serialize(w io.Writer) error {
_, err := w.Write(u[:])
return err
}
// Deserialize deserializes the uuid from the reader
func (u *UUID) Deserialize(r io.Reader) error {
_, err := io.ReadFull(r, u[:])
return err
}
// Packet is a structure that can be serialized or deserialized from
// Minecraft connection
type Packet interface {
write(io.Writer) error
read(io.Reader) error
id() int
}
